25.01.2022 Using windscreen wipers on a misty morning is equivalent to tuning a depth sounder to improve visibility. Clouds of herring can smother the bottom, the same ...as thick fog restricting your view of the countryside. If in search of animals you may need to look closely for the flicker of an ear, or the shape of rabbit or kangaroo bent over feeding in the grass. The sonar snapshot below reinforces why a trained eye is critical when interpreting sonar images. A huge school (tens of thousands) of 120mm herring cover the bottom, hiding the predators patiently waiting below. Not only can some predators colour match their surroundings but they can mimic the rocky cover. The 15kg estuary cod has been detected below the bait school, the looong spaghetti-like marking is highlighted for your benefit. The vessel is stationary, the screen still scrolling, the cod remaining within the signal beam for a long time and therefore marking as a continuous line. This is just one example of how important it is to understand your sonar, plus the habits of marine life and intended target species. It took two minutes to catch the cod once it was identified- rigging and presenting a bait to suit its hunting style.
